summaryrefslogtreecommitdiff
path: root/poezio/ui/render.py
diff options
context:
space:
mode:
authormathieui <mathieui@mathieui.net>2019-09-29 12:20:00 +0200
committermathieui <mathieui@mathieui.net>2020-05-09 19:46:17 +0200
commit5bc510eafa5d3e9c735687f0b8c9d446159fffca (patch)
treee00c4b890c0c7e09c32a227b14ae90c0869c6a38 /poezio/ui/render.py
parent32beeca48018422499b9c0af55a5c5b1eaa67d75 (diff)
downloadpoezio-5bc510eafa5d3e9c735687f0b8c9d446159fffca.tar.gz
poezio-5bc510eafa5d3e9c735687f0b8c9d446159fffca.tar.bz2
poezio-5bc510eafa5d3e9c735687f0b8c9d446159fffca.tar.xz
poezio-5bc510eafa5d3e9c735687f0b8c9d446159fffca.zip
Fix an issue in xmllog rendering due to wrong offset
and improve tests to catch that
Diffstat (limited to 'poezio/ui/render.py')
-rw-r--r--poezio/ui/render.py4
1 files changed, 2 insertions, 2 deletions
diff --git a/poezio/ui/render.py b/poezio/ui/render.py
index 64b480a9..b695e8f3 100644
--- a/poezio/ui/render.py
+++ b/poezio/ui/render.py
@@ -100,7 +100,7 @@ def build_xmllog(msg: XMLLog, width: int, timestamp: bool, nick_size: int = 10)
def write_pre(msg: BaseMessage, win, with_timestamps: bool, nick_size: int) -> int:
"""Write the part before text (only the timestamp)"""
if with_timestamps:
- return 1 + PreMessageHelpers.write_time(win, False, msg.time)
+ return PreMessageHelpers.write_time(win, False, msg.time)
return 0
@@ -153,7 +153,7 @@ def write_pre_xmllog(msg: XMLLog, win, with_timestamps: bool, nick_size: int) ->
"""Write the part before the stanza (timestamp + IN/OUT)"""
offset = 0
if with_timestamps:
- offset += PreMessageHelpers.write_time(win, False, msg.time)
+ offset += 1 + PreMessageHelpers.write_time(win, False, msg.time)
theme = get_theme()
if msg.incoming:
char = theme.CHAR_XML_IN